Our Work
The growth in demand for renewable chemicals continues to outpace supply to meet the needs of industry and answer some of the issues of climate change. Formative is building a green chemicals roadmap, planning for the roll-out of multiple facilities producing a variety of chemicals from a range of renewable feedstocks.
To look at it simply, greenhouse gas (CO2) releases are a function of poor carbon utilization. Formative fine tunes its technologies to optimize carbon usage and minimize carbon emissions. Formative is designing facilities to convert greater than 90% of the feedstock carbon into desired products.

Hydroelectric Power
Reliable Power Supply And CO2 Emissions Mitigation. A three-stage hydroelectric project is currently under development in central Africa. All Conceptual work has been completed and required permits and licenses have been obtained.
Green Ammonia
Enabling Job Creation And CO2 Emissions Mitigation While Delivering Attractive Financial Returns. The Northern Cape (South Africa) is viewed as an “optimal” location for green hydrogen production. Utilize renewable power to produce hydrogen via electrolysis and then convert it to green ammonia (NH3).
Project Luhlaza
Two million tons of raw materials for 100% green chemicals. Formative Capital has taken its first project through pre-feasibility, and beyond FEL-2, progressing to where Formative has a Class 3 capital (+25% / -10%) estimate on hand. We are entering into the design and implementation phase and expect to be producing products about 36 months after construction commences.
